#ifndef _PAYSAGES_ATMOSPHERE_PUBLIC_H_
#define _PAYSAGES_ATMOSPHERE_PUBLIC_H_
#include "../shared/types.h"
#include "../euclid.h"
#include "../color.h"
#include "../pack.h"
#include "../layers.h"
#ifdef __cplusplus
extern "C" {
#endif
typedef enum
{
ATMOSPHERE_MODEL_PREETHAM = 0,
ATMOSPHERE_MODEL_BRUNETON = 1
} AtmosphereModel;
typedef struct
{
AtmosphereModel model;
double daytime;
double humidity;
Color sun_color;
double sun_radius;
double sun_halo_size;
Curve* sun_halo_profile;
double dome_lighting;
} AtmosphereDefinition;
typedef int (*FuncAtmosphereGetSkydomeLights)(Renderer* renderer, LightDefinition* array, int max_lights);
typedef Color (*FuncAtmosphereApplyAerialPerspective)(Renderer* renderer, Vector3 location, Color base);
typedef Color (*FuncAtmosphereGetSkyColor)(Renderer* renderer, Vector3 direction);
typedef Vector3 (*FuncAtmosphereGetSunDirection)(Renderer* renderer);
typedef struct
{
AtmosphereDefinition* definition;
FuncAtmosphereGetSkydomeLights getSkydomeLights;
FuncAtmosphereApplyAerialPerspective applyAerialPerspective;
FuncAtmosphereGetSkyColor getSkyColor;
FuncAtmosphereGetSunDirection getSunDirection;
void* _internal_data;
} AtmosphereRenderer;
extern StandardDefinition AtmosphereDefinitionClass;
extern StandardRenderer AtmosphereRendererClass;
void atmosphereRenderSkydome(Renderer* renderer);
Renderer atmosphereCreatePreviewRenderer();
Color atmosphereGetPreview(Renderer* renderer, double x, double y, double heading);
#ifdef __cplusplus
}
#endif
#endif
